2. India Issues Safety Advisory for Nationals
As Iran-US Tensions Escalate, India’s government issued a formal safety advisory. Citizens have been advised to avoid sensitive areas, limit outdoor movement in high-risk zones, and register with Indian embassies.
Indian missions in the region have activated emergency helplines. Authorities are also coordinating with local governments to ensure rapid response if evacuation becomes necessary.
The advisory emphasizes preparedness rather than panic. Officials clarified that there is no immediate evacuation order, but contingency plans are ready.

5. Impact on Indian Diaspora
More than eight million Indians live and work across the Gulf region. As Iran-US Tensions Escalate, families in India are closely following updates.
The government has reassured citizens that embassies are prepared to provide assistance. Community organizations are also helping spread verified information.
Travel agencies report a temporary dip in bookings to affected regions. Airlines are reviewing flight paths to avoid potential risk zones.

Travel Advisory Details for Indian Citizens
The advisory issued as Iran-US Tensions Escalate outlines clear guidelines:
- Avoid non-essential travel to high-risk zones
- Stay updated through embassy notifications
- Maintain valid travel documents
- Keep emergency contact numbers accessible
- Follow instructions from local authorities
Indian students and workers have been asked to inform families about their safety and remain connected through official channels.
Authorities stressed that misinformation can spread quickly during geopolitical crises. Citizens are advised to rely only on verified government sources.
